Output 7ab315ca8fc22f3db8b182de2dce5214030b7e51c78f77df6b5a6cd6c25c2014:1

value
1004419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aaff7cd86293405aa10702f39f9337bdc984fa3 OP_EQUAL
address
MDFUE2TVXWnTKJSSTp5d9TJda6Dzh94uAd
transaction
7ab315ca8fc22f3db8b182de2dce5214030b7e51c78f77df6b5a6cd6c25c2014
spent
true